What is economic?

Economics is a set of economic sciences, a type of social science that studies the relationship between people in the production, consumption, distribution, and exchange of goods or services. The subject of economic theory is how people and society choose to use limited resources.

What is economic?

In addition to the basic one, there are several other definitions of economics put forward by scientists over the years. Its founder as a separate science is considered to be Adam Smith.

Economics was also called political economy, but from the second half of the nineteenth century it became politically neutral, and the word “politics” was excluded from the definition. Nowadays, economics is considered to predict the outcome of certain political decisions without interfering with politics.

Historically, economics has come a long way. Its main directions were mercantilism of XV-XVIII centuries, physiocracy of the second half of XVIII century, classical political economy of the end of XVIII century – 30s of XIX century, neoclassical economics which appeared in 1890s, Keynesianism and monetarism of XX century. A separate direction in economics – a peculiar offshoot of it – is Marxism.

The subject of the study of economics is not values, but agents of economic activity, such as individual households and society as a whole. That is why economics belongs to the social sciences.

On the scale of the study it is divided into microeconomics, the subject of which is organizations and households, and the study of the functioning of the economy as a whole.

Microeconomics looks at individual agents and their choices: what and for whom to produce, consume, how to interact in the process of exchange, etc. It studies the efficiency of production, cost, supply and demand, the specialization of economic agents, uncertainty and game theory.

The main macroeconomic indicators are unemployment, inflation, economic growth, monetary and monetary policy, and business cycles.

In addition to macro- and microeconomics, economic sciences include the following disciplines: econometrics, economic statistics, history of economic teachings and economic history, management, marketing, branch economics, engineering economics, enterprise economics and labor economics, accounting, managerial and financial accounting, etc.
